۷ منبع عالی برای برنامه های کاربردی توییتر

ارسال شده توسط AmirTnT | در وب 2 | تاریخ ۰۸-۰۶-۱۳۸۸ | بازديد ها : 498

۱

7 Tweerrific.com 7 منبع عالی برای برنامه های کاربردی توییتر

هر روزه برنامه های کاربردی زیادی با استفاده از API توییتر نوشته می شوند.من در این پست ۷ سایت منبع برای این برنامه های کاربردی را جدا کرده ام که در ادامه مطلب به معرفی آنها می پردازم.

نمایش دادن اولین عکس موجود در پست

ارسال شده توسط AmirTnT | در کد نویسی | تاریخ ۰۵-۰۶-۱۳۸۸ | بازديد ها : 1,026

۱۷

نمایش عکس بندانگشتی پست

اکثر کاربران ودپرس برای قرار دادن عکس های بند انگشتی از زمینه های دلخواه استفاده می کنند.این روش خوبی هست ولی یک روش آسان و بهتر برای این کار وجود دارد که با تغییراتی در فایل های قالب امکان پذیر هست.

ابتدا کد زیر را در فایل functions.php قالب کپی کنید :

function catch_that_image() {
  global $post, $posts;
  $first_img = '';
  ob_start();
  ob_end_clean();
  $output = preg_match_all('/<img.+src=[\'"]([^\'"]+)[\'"].*>/i', $post->post_content, $matches);
  $first_img = $matches [1] [0];

  if(empty($first_img)){ //Defines a default image
    $first_img = "/images/default.jpg";
  }
  return $first_img;
}

خب از این به بعد شما می تونید با قرار دادن کد زیر در حلقه وردپرس اولین عکس پست را فراخوانی کنید:

<?php echo catch_that_image() ?>

به همین سادگی … :)

انتقال مطالب از جوملا به وردپرس

ارسال شده توسط AmirTnT | در انتقال, وردپرس | تاریخ ۲۶-۰۵-۱۳۸۸ | بازديد ها : 959

۲۸

joomla to wordpress انتقال مطالب از جوملا به وردپرس

این روزها بحث انتقال مطالب از سیستم های دیگر به سیستم قدرتمند وردپرس خیلی مطرح می شه.سیستم هایی مدیریت محتوایی که در ایران رواج دارند سیستم هایی هستند از قبیل جوملا،مامبو،دیتالایف،نیوک،دروپال و چند تا دیگه.خوشبختانه واسه انتقال از این سیستم ها به وردپرس راه وجود داره.

قصد دارم راه انتقال از همه سیستم های رایج در ایران به وردپرس رو بنویسم و الان هم از جوملا شروع می کنم.

ساخت ادامه مطلب اختصاصی برای هر دسته

ارسال شده توسط AmirTnT | در وردپرس, کد نویسی | تاریخ ۱۹-۰۵-۱۳۸۸ | بازديد ها : 1,192

۲۰

سلام :

امروز یه آموزشی می دم که می تونید با اون برای مطالب هر دسته یک قالب ادامه مطلب یا همون single.php مخصوص در وردپرس اختصاص بدید.

خب ادامه مطلب ها یا همون صفحه مخصوص هر مطلب در سیستم وردپرس کد هاشون در فایل single.php وجود داره و از این فایل استفاده می شه.

برای اینکه ما برای مطالب یک دسته خاص از یک قالب دیگه استفاده کنیم باید مراحل زیر رو انجام بدیم :

۱- ساخت فایل قالب مورد نظر

ابتدا شما باید یک فایل single متفاوت بری دسته خودتون بسازید و اون رو اینطوری نام گذاری کنید : single_categoryid.php

که به جای id ، آی دی دسته مورد نظر رو می نویسید.

شما باید یک فایل single هم بسازید که برای دسته های معمولی استفاده بشه و اون رو با نام single_default.php  ذخیره کنید.

۲- نوشتن دستور شرطی

خب وقتی فایل ها رو ساختید باید فایل single.php قالبتون رو باز کنید و کد های زیر رو به جای کدهای اون قرار بدید :

<?php post;
if ( in_category('2') ) {
include(TEMPLATEPATH . '/single_category2.php'); }
elseif ( in_category('3') ) {
include(TEMPLATEPATH . '/single_category3.php'); }
elseif ( in_category('4') ) {
include(TEMPLATEPATH . '/single_category4.php'); }
else { include(TEMPLATEPATH . '/single_default.php'); } ?>

خب اگه به کد ها دقت کنید متوجه می شید که مثلا اون عدد های ۳ یا ۴ چیه … بله اینا آی دی همون دسته هایی هست که می خواید ادامه مطلبشون متفاوت باشه که باید یا توجه به آی دی دسته خودتون تغییر بدید.

حالا این کد بالا چی کار می کنه؟

کد بالا ابتدا دسته رو چک می کنه اگه همون دسته مورد نظر شما بود فایل اون رو فراخوانی می کنه و اگه اون نبود فایل single_default.php رو فراخوانی می کنه.

نکته : شما می تونید به تعداد دلخواه دسته به اون کد اضافه کنید فقط کافیه که کد :

elseif ( in_category('id') ) {
 include(TEMPLATEPATH . '/single_categoryid.php'); }

رو به تعداد دلخواه به کد بالا اضافه کنید و به جای id ، شماره دسته مورد نظرتون رو قرار بدید.

اینم یکی دیگه از قابلیت های وردپرس … موفق باشید